本文主要是介绍Android5.1以太网相关记录,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
http://blog.csdn.net/yanleizhouqing/article/details/49443965
很久没写日志,主要最近工作比较繁忙,最近主要做以太网开发的。
平台: 高通 ,Android 4.3 ,Linux 3.4.0
这一部分,主要说一下,调试过程中用到的一些命令。以太网,是由usb转net出来的,主要在在deconfig中配出usb_net这个配置就可以。
下面主要说的一些调试命令:
1. netcfg 查看当前的网卡设备名及其相关信息:
2. netcfg 动态连接网络:
netcfg eth0 dhcp up 给eth0动态分配IP、网关
一般这里,调用netcfg 查看信息,看是否分配出ip,若成功,则ping 192.168.3.0(网关),然后ping 114.114.114.114,若都能成功,则表示你的网络是没有问题,此时你的设备无法通过浏览器上网,这需要调通framework层。
3. netcfg 静态连接网络:
netcfg eth0 down
netcfg eth0 192.168.3.123 netmask 255.255.255.0 up 设置IP
route add default gw 192.168.3.1 dev eth0 设置网关
setprop net.dns1 192.168.3.1 设置DNS
一般到这里,应该能ping通网关并且能ping通百度。
检测硬件的以太网状态
http://blog.csdn.net/hclydao/article/details/50972932
修改framework的以太网设置
需要中间层设置
1,
2,
这篇关于Android5.1以太网相关记录的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!